Algeria reported yesterday that it was sending a second team of rescuers this Thursday to substitute the team that has been operating in Derna, in eastern Libya, for ten days.
The same sources confirmed that this second team of 77 people will take over from the previous one, with the same specialities and the same equipment, and will be fresher to continue the search and rescue work in an optimal manner.
